Once your radio controlled clock has synchronized, it won't decode the signal from WWVB again for a while. Like a traditional AM radio station, time information is encoded in the WWVB broadcast by changes in the strength or amplitude of the radio signal. Popular radio-controlled timekeepers, which range from wristwatches to wall clocks, are not really atomic clocksthough that's often in their namebut they do set themselves by listening to low-frequency AM time broadcasts from the NIST radio station WWVB in Fort Collins, Colo. Those broadcasts are synchronized to the NIST atomic clock ensemble in nearby Boulder, Colo.
